About Shield AI

Shield AI

Shield AI is a venture-backed defense technology company specializing in artificial intelligence, autonomous systems, and next-generation military aviation. Founded in 2015 and headquartered in San Diego, the company is focused on building advanced software and hardware solutions that enable military forces to operate effectively in the most contested, denied, and high-risk environments. Its technologies are designed to function where traditional systems fail—particularly in GPS-denied, communications-disrupted, and highly dynamic combat scenarios.

At the core of Shield AI’s innovation is its emphasis on software-driven autonomy. Rather than relying on remote human operators, the company develops AI-powered “pilots” capable of independently navigating complex missions, making real-time decisions, and executing objectives with speed and precision. This approach allows autonomous systems to operate with greater resilience, reduced latency, and significantly enhanced survivability in modern warfare environments.
